Then during COVID, alongside childhood friends, I co-founded and helped scale an ecommerce education company that eventually grew to over 5,500 students and around 20 staff. I want to be really clear about something, that was not something I did on my own. It came from hard work, yes, but also from being around good people who had skills and knowledge that were stronger than mine in certain areas. That experience taught me something really powerful: you have to lean into your strengths. And when it comes to your weaknesses, you have two choices. Either you spend the time developing them, or you bring in someone who is already great at that thing. In reality, if you want to grow something properly, you’ll probably need to do both. You can’t do everything alone, and as a business grows, it forces you to grow too. You have to keep learning, keep adapting, and keep pushing. If you’re not doing that, you end up standing still. 

During this period, I wasn’t just developing my consulting skills through working directly with students — I was also learning sales, marketing, systems, hiring, and leadership in real time. Early on, I was in the trenches, coaching students 1-on-1 over Zoom and helping them through whatever stage they were at inside the program. That hands-on experience became incredibly valuable later, because when you’ve done the role yourself, you understand how to improve it and hire the right people to eventually replace you. As the business scaled and we brought on sales staff, coaches, and appointment setters, my role evolved into COO and one of three executive team members, with a clear focus on team growth, hiring, training, systems, and culture.

I started in sales by taking calls myself, before moving into hiring, training and developing the team as we scaled. We hired aggressively, built out our departments, and I became heavily involved in creating the systems behind the growth — hiring processes, onboarding, SOPs, KPIs, training frameworks, and leadership structures across multiple roles. As the team expanded across Australia and internationally, I gained hands-on experience in hiring, managing, and building structure within a fast-moving digital business. At that point, my role became about balancing execution and innovation — keeping the machine running through strong people, culture, and performance, while also constantly looking for ways to optimise systems, improve delivery, and support further growth. That season taught me how to grow with a business — from doing the work myself, to building teams that could do it at scale.
